This tumblr exists for the express purpose of campaigning for Tanis Parenteau to be cast as Johanna Mason in the film sequels to The Hunger Games.

Johanna is from District 7, the lumber-producing district of Panem that is most likely located in the northwestern U.S. and southern parts of the Canadian provinces of Alberta and British Columbia. Johanna has dark brown eyes and hair and throws axes. Personally, I really like the idea of an indigenous Johanna.

Tanis Parenteau is a Métis actress from Alberta. She’s incredibly athletic and trained in stage combat.
